This is an expanded edition of a previously published work. Two chapters have been added to this revised edition. In the summer of 1990, S. Y. Cheng and S.-T. Yau organized a conference in Los Angeles in honor of their professor, S. S. Chern, on the occasion of his seventy-ninth birthday. Published here are personal reminiscences from Chern's large group of friends and students. These lectures reflect the wisdom of this great mathematician and his warmth in interacting with young geometers. The editors hope that through this book, readers might get a glimpse of the life of a great geometer.Editorials

Contains technical essays and reminiscences by students of a geometry professor on the occasion of his 79th birthday, plus an essay by Chern on his mathematical education in China. Technical topics include Chern's influence on value distribution, the normal Gauss map of a tight smooth surface in R3, Riemannian manifolds, and open problems in differential geometry. Includes some 25 pages of b&w photos. No index. Annotation c. by Book News, Inc., Portland, Or.Book Details
